1. 什么是虚拟币钱包充值地址串码? 虚拟币钱包充值地址串码是通过特定算法生成的字符串,它代表着一个唯一的地...
在如今的信息时代,助记词已经成为了数字资产安全的重要组成部分。无论是区块链钱包、数字货币还是密码学安全领域,助记词的使用都变得越来越普遍。但与此同时,关于助记词的安全性和碰撞几率的问题也逐渐浮出水面。在本文中,我们将深入探讨助记词的随机碰撞几率,分析其在安全性方面的重要性,并回答一些可能与之相关的问题。
助记词(Mnemonic Phrase)是由一组单词组成的序列,用于帮助用户记录和恢复他们的数字资产。它的本质是通过简单易记的方式,存储复杂的信息,通常用于加密货币钱包等场景。助记词的生成常常遵循一定的方法,如BIP39标准,用户可以通过这些单词恢复他们的钱包地址和私钥。
随机碰撞几率是统计学和密码学中的一个重要概念,特别是在谈到助记词时,更是直接关系到用户资产的安全。在助记词系统中,由于助记词通常包含多个单词(例如12个、15个或24个单词),这些单词可以从一组固定的单词库中选择。因此,在生成助记词时,存在一定的随机性,导致了碰撞的可能性。
碰撞的定义是指两个不同的数据输入生成相同的哈希值,在助记词的情境中,则意味着两组助记词在生成后指向相同的私钥或钱包地址。这会引起极大的安全隐患,特别是对用户的数字资产。
以BIP39为例,BIP39标准提供了2048个单词的词汇表。这意味着在生成12个单词的助记词时,其可能组合数为2048的12次方,约合2.66 x 10^39种可能性,随机碰撞的几率极低。在绝大多数情况下,用户无需担心会出现碰撞。
助记词的安全性直接涉及到密码学的基础,通过防止随机碰撞,可以确保用户在生成助记词后,其资产不会面临被盗或丢失的风险。值得注意的是,虽然理论上碰撞几率非常小,但在实际使用中,助记词的存储和管理却受到许多因素影响。
首先,助记词的存储方式至关重要。如果用户将其存储在不安全的地方,或者通过不安全的网络进行传输,就可能面临人为攻击的风险。例如,黑客可以通过键盘记录程序或恶意软件获取用户的助记词,从而控制用户的数字资产。在这种情况下,即便助记词的随机生成算法足够安全,但只要助记词被攻击者掌握,仍然无法避免资产丢失。
提高助记词的安全性可以从几个方面入手。首先,用户应该选择一个强大且可靠的助记词生成器,确保生成的助记词具有足够的随机性。此外,用户也可以考虑使用硬件钱包或冷存储方式,将助记词离线存储,防止因网络连接导致的安全问题。
其次,用户在保存助记词时,应避免使用易受到攻击的设备。此外,要定期检查助记词的安全性,这样可以在潜在风险出现之前采取适当的措施。例如,定期更改助记词或检测潜在的设备安全隐患,都能有效提高资产的安全性。
助记词的生成方式有几种,其中最常见的是基于BIP39标准。该标准明确了一组2048个单词,用户可以从中随机选择,组合成助记词。用户输入一个随机数,这个随机数通过编码转换成为助记词,确保其安全性。除了BIP39外,还有一些其他生成算法,例如通过随机字母和数字生成等,但主要还是依赖于BIP39的使用。
如果用户不慎丢失助记词,恢复数字资产几乎是不可能的。因为大多数基于助记词的系统不提供任何找回方法。因此,用户在使用助记词时,务必将其安全备份,保留在多个安全的地方,甚至可以考虑使用保险箱等方式保存,而不是仅仅依靠设备或互联网上的云服务保存。
助记词的碰撞几率通常被认为是非常安全的,因其组合数量巨大。但这并不意味着用户可以完全依赖于此。实际应用中,用户应将助记词的安全性与保管方式结合考虑,适当采取硬件存储、加密工具等,以确保在碰撞几率极小的基础上,进一步增强资产的安全性。
在理论上,可以使用自定义助记词,但这需要确保所选的单词组合具有足够的随机性,并且实现方式要符合相关的安全标准。自定义助记词还需避免过于简单的组合,否则容易被破解。此外,用户需保证自定义助记词的安全存储,否则面临的风险与使用易于猜测的密码类似。
总结一下,助记词是现代信息安全领域中不可或缺的一部分。通过理解助记词的生成原理、随机碰撞几率以及安全性问题,用户能够更好地保护他们的数字资产。希望本文能够帮助读者更深入地理解助记词的相关知识,提升其在密码学和数字资产管理中的应用能力。